Las Gaviotas
One of the most inspiring stories of sustainable development in recent years is the establishment of the Las Gaviotas community on the eastern savannas of Colombia in Central America. Considered to be one of the richest ecosystems in the world, Colombia is situated upon the equator with a range of natural elevations ideal for the efflorescence of an extraordinary abundance of biological diversity. With a highly educated and literate population, the country produces more than a hundred exportable crops and has developed a large range of manufacturing industries including textiles, chemicals, electrical apparatus and transport equipment.

However, since the late 1940s Colombia has been principally known for an ongoing cycle of violence associated with the struggle between government forces and the Fuerzas Armadas Revolucionarias de Colombia or the FARC. This ongoing struggle, coupled with the well- publicised narcotics trade, has established Colombia as one of the most dangerous places on earth. Yet despite the very real social crisis, Gaviotas has managed to create one of the worlds most significant sustainable communities and in 1997 was awarded the World prize in Zero Emissions from the United Nations Zero Emissions Research Initiative.
